Show / Hide Table of Contents

Class ReflectedActionData

Inheritance
System.Object
ReflectedActionData
Namespace: BennyKok.RuntimeDebug.Data
Assembly: com.bennykok.runtime-debug-action.dll
Syntax
public class ReflectedActionData

Fields

attribute

Declaration
public DebugActionAttribute attribute
Field Value
Type Description
DebugActionAttribute

fieldInfo

Declaration
public FieldInfo fieldInfo
Field Value
Type Description
System.Reflection.FieldInfo

methodInfo

Declaration
public MethodInfo methodInfo
Field Value
Type Description
System.Reflection.MethodInfo

parameterInfos

Declaration
public ParameterInfo[] parameterInfos
Field Value
Type Description
System.Reflection.ParameterInfo[]

propertyInfo

Declaration
public PropertyInfo propertyInfo
Field Value
Type Description
System.Reflection.PropertyInfo

Methods

GetActionName()

Declaration
public string GetActionName()
Returns
Type Description
System.String

GetBoolValue(Object)

Declaration
public bool GetBoolValue(object obj)
Parameters
Type Name Description
System.Object obj
Returns
Type Description
System.Boolean

GetFlagDisplay()

Declaration
public string[] GetFlagDisplay()
Returns
Type Description
System.String[]

GetFlagValue(Object)

Declaration
public int GetFlagValue(object obj)
Parameters
Type Name Description
System.Object obj
Returns
Type Description
System.Int32

GetTargetType()

Declaration
public Type GetTargetType()
Returns
Type Description
System.Type

GetValue(Object)

Declaration
public object GetValue(object obj)
Parameters
Type Name Description
System.Object obj
Returns
Type Description
System.Object

IsBoolean()

Declaration
public bool IsBoolean()
Returns
Type Description
System.Boolean

IsButton()

Declaration
public bool IsButton()
Returns
Type Description
System.Boolean

IsEnum()

Declaration
public bool IsEnum()
Returns
Type Description
System.Boolean

IsFloat()

Declaration
public bool IsFloat()
Returns
Type Description
System.Boolean

IsInput()

Declaration
public bool IsInput()
Returns
Type Description
System.Boolean

IsInt()

Declaration
public bool IsInt()
Returns
Type Description
System.Boolean

IsString()

Declaration
public bool IsString()
Returns
Type Description
System.Boolean

SetValue(Object, Object)

Declaration
public void SetValue(object obj, object value)
Parameters
Type Name Description
System.Object obj
System.Object value
In This Article
👆 RuntimeDebugAction by ❤️ BennyKok